Abstract

Geographical indication is part of the Intellectual Property regulated in the Law Number 20 of 2016 on Trademarks and Geographic Indications, Tangkit pineapple is a typical Pineapples Village of New Tangit district of Muaro Jambi which must be protected in order to obtain legal protection of Geographic Indication. The aim of this research is to identify and analyze the economic benefits for communal communities that are integrated into the MPIG Nanas New Infection Group. To identify the role of the government in optimizing the utilization of Geographical Indications for the new Infection Society. The basic problems in this research are: 1) How the economic benefit for the communal community that is integrated in the new infection MPIG Group is formed. 2) How the government's role in optimising the use of geographical indications for new infected communities. This research uses empirical methods of jurisprudence with data collection techniques using observations, interviews and documentation. The conclusion of the results of the discussion in the research showed that: 1) The form of economic benefits made by the people of the village of Tangkit New to increase the revenue of the region is to manage UMKM or home industry by processing pineapple fruit into various kinds of processed products. 2) The role of the Muaro Jambi Government in optimizing the use of Geographical Indications is to provide support in the provision of guidance and training as well as facility assistance.
